Essential Info
The X10 Variable Temperature Sensor provides a way to sense temperatures and trigger X10 devices based on user settings. It interfaces to a standard X10 Powerflash Interface, sold separately, and supports a temperature range from approximately 0° F - 120° F.
The sensor is completely self contained and uses a solid state transducer preset at the factory. There are three leads extending from the sensor. Depending on your application, the user selection of leads determines turning on or off devices based on whether the temperature is hotter than the set value or cooler than the set value. The user selects two leads, sets the approximate temperature using a small screwdriver, connects the sensor to the Powerflash terminals, plugs in the wall transformer, and places the sensor in the appropriate location.

Operations For best results, let the sensor sit in the environment for 1 hour prior to use in order to allow the temperature to stabilize and begin normal operation. For residential use only.
Modes 1) Turns on all Lamp modules set to the same house code as the Powerflash. Turns on Appliance modules set to the same house and unit code as the Powerflash. After the temperature returns to normal, all modules set to the same house and unit code will be turned off. 2) Flashes all lamp modules set to the same house code. If temperature returns to normal, all lights remain on. 3) Turns on Lamp and Appliance modules set to the same house code and unit code as the interface. After the temperature returns to normal it will turn these same modules off.
